No. 9 seed Florida Atlantic and No. 8 seed Memphis face off on Friday in an NCAA Tournament first-round game.

The game is scheduled for 6:20 p.m. MST and can be seen on TNT.

Memphis is a 2.5-point favorite in the game, according to Tipico Sportsbook.

FanDuel: Memphis 80, Florida Atlantic 75

Larry Rupp writes: "Memphis just took down a Houston team that is slated as a No. 1 seed in the NCAA Tournament and has also beaten Texas A&M, Auburn, and VCU. That's four wins against teams in the tournament field. The Tigers are led by senior Kendric Davis, who is averaging 22.1 points per game (No. 9 in NCAA). Memphis has won 18 of its last 20 games against a Conference USA team, so back the Tigers."

Sportsbook Wire: Memphis 74, Florida Atlantic 73

It writes: "Memphis has put together a 16-16-2 ATS record so far this year. Florida Atlantic has compiled a 21-11-0 ATS record so far this season."

Sports Chat Place: Take Florida Atlantic with the points vs. Memphis

Randy Chambers writes: "The Memphis Tigers are getting the benefit of the doubt here just because, but this line should tell you that FAU is nothing to be played with. While the schedule hasn’t been difficult, FAU does just about everything right, has a combination of athleticism and size and is as well coached as any team in the land. We’ve backed FAU a lot this season, and I don’t see a reason to stop now. FAU could win this game and give Purdue all it could handle in the next round. Don’t sleep on the Owls."

Sporting News: Go with Memphis against Florida Atlantic

Gilbert McGregor writes: "With respect to experience, Williams and guard Alex Lomax both took the floor for Memphis in last year's tournament. As this is FAU's first tournament appearance since 2002, transfer guard Jalen Gaffney is the only player on the roster with NCAA Tournament experience from his time at UConn."
